Course OutlineWeek Dates Topics
1 13/02/2018 Introduction, fundamental definitions, historical development of biomimicry
2 20/02/2018 Natural mechanisms and their biomimetic applications in aerodynamics, winglets design
3 27/02/2018 Bio-inspired design examples, biologically inspired mechanisms and machines
4 06/03/2018 Bioinspired vehicle design
5 13/03/2018 Biomimetic applications in materials, composites
6 20/03/2018 Biomimetic applications in electronics, optics
7 27/03/2018 Biomimetic applications in energy
8 03/04/2018 Bioinspired photonic materials
9 10/04/2018 MIDTERM EXAMS: APRIL 07-15
10 17/04/201 Biologically inspired smart materials, sensors, robots.
11 24/04/2018 Biomimetic applications in structures, manufacturing.
12 01/05/2018 Labor and Solidarity Day
13 08/05/2018 Biomimetic surfaces
14 15/05/2018 Smart materials, biomaterials, biocompatible materials

Biomimetics or Biomimicry: Biomimicry is an approach to innovation that seeks sustainable solutions to human challenges by emulating nature’s patterns and strategies.

Biomimetics is an interdisciplinary field in which principles from engineering, chemistry and biology are applied to the synthesis of materials, synthetic systems or machines that have functions that mimic biological processes.
